The Impact of Clocks on Workplace Injuries in Nigeria

In Nigeria, workplace safety has always been a critical issue, with concerns ranging from physical hazards to more subtle factors that can contribute to incidents. One such factor that often goes unnoticed is the role that clocks play in workplace injuries. While clocks are essential for time management and productivity, their presence can also unwittingly lead to accidents and injuries in a variety of work settings. One of the primary ways in which clocks can contribute to workplace injuries is by creating a sense of time pressure among workers. In a fast-paced environment where deadlines loom large, employees may feel compelled to rush through tasks to meet arbitrary time constraints imposed by the clock. This can lead to sloppy workmanship, increased stress levels, and a higher likelihood of accidents occurring. Moreover, the constant ticking of clocks can create a distraction for workers, especially in noisy environments where concentration is key. Workers may find themselves glancing at the clock frequently, taking their focus away from the task at hand and increasing the risk of making mistakes or mishandling equipment. In industries where precision and attention to detail are crucial, such as manufacturing or healthcare, the presence of clocks can be particularly problematic. Workers racing against the clock to complete tasks may overlook safety protocols or fail to adhere to proper procedures, putting themselves and their colleagues at risk of injury. Furthermore, the use of analog clocks in workplaces with machinery or equipment that operates at high speeds can pose a danger to workers. A momentary lapse in judgment while checking the time on a clock could result in a severe injury if a worker's hand or clothing gets caught in moving parts. To mitigate the risk of workplace injuries associated with clocks, employers in Nigeria can take several proactive measures. Firstly, they can provide comprehensive training on time management and stress management techniques to enable employees to work efficiently without feeling overwhelmed by the ticking clock. Additionally, employers can consider installing digital clocks or time-tracking systems that are visible but less intrusive than traditional analog clocks. Ultimately, while clocks are indispensable tools for timekeeping in the workplace, it is essential for employers and employees alike to be mindful of the potential risks they pose. By fostering a culture of mindfulness, safety, and respect for time, workplaces in Nigeria can create a conducive environment where employees can work productively without compromising their well-being.
